基于ssm+VUE的电影售票微信小程序源码数据库.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
该压缩包文件“基于ssm+VUE的电影售票微信小程序源码数据库.zip”是一个包含完整项目源码的资源,适用于进行毕业设计或学习微信小程序、Android以及SpringBoot等相关技术。下面将详细介绍其中涉及的关键技术和知识领域。 1. **SSM框架**: SSM是Spring、SpringMVC和MyBatis的缩写,是一个流行的企业级Java应用开发框架。Spring提供依赖注入和事务管理,SpringMVC处理Web请求,MyBatis则作为持久层框架,负责数据库操作。在这个项目中,SSM被用来构建后端服务,处理来自微信小程序的请求,执行业务逻辑并与数据库交互。 2. **Vue.js**: Vue.js是一个轻量级的前端JavaScript框架,用于构建用户界面。它采用组件化的方式,使得代码结构清晰,易于维护。在本项目中,Vue.js用于微信小程序的开发,创建交互式的用户界面,展示电影信息、座位选择、购票流程等。 3. **微信小程序**: 微信小程序是腾讯公司推出的一种无需下载安装即可使用的应用程序。开发者可以使用微信提供的开发工具和API,编写小程序并发布到微信平台。本项目利用微信小程序的API,实现了电影票购买功能,用户可以在微信内直接完成购票流程。 4. **SpringBoot**: SpringBoot是Spring框架的一个扩展,旨在简化Spring应用的初始搭建以及开发过程。它预设了许多默认配置,使得开发者能够快速启动项目。在这个项目中,SpringBoot可能用于构建RESTful API,为微信小程序提供数据服务。 5. **Android**: 虽然标题和描述没有明确指出Android部分,但通常一个完整的移动应用解决方案会考虑到多平台支持。因此,这个项目可能也包含了Android客户端的源码,以便用户在Android设备上也能使用购票功能。Android开发涉及Java或Kotlin编程,使用Android Studio IDE,以及Android SDK。 6. **数据库设计**: 项目中必然包含了数据库设计,可能包括了电影信息表、放映时间表、座位表、订单表等。数据库管理系统的选用未在描述中提及,但常见的选择可能是MySQL或Oracle,用于存储和检索各类业务数据。 7. **API设计与调用**: 微信小程序和Android客户端会通过HTTP或HTTPS请求调用后端的API接口,获取数据或提交请求。这涉及到JSON数据格式的使用,以及状态码、错误处理等机制。 8. **前端页面与后端服务通信**: Vue.js的组件通过Ajax(如axios库)与SpringBoot提供的REST API进行通信,实现前后端分离。前端负责展示和用户交互,后端处理业务逻辑和数据存储。 9. **版本控制**: 开发过程中,通常会使用Git进行版本控制,便于团队协作和代码管理。 这个项目涵盖了Java后端开发、前端Web开发、移动端开发以及数据库管理等多个IT领域的技术,对于学习和理解现代企业级应用的开发流程具有很高的参考价值。
- 1
- 粉丝: 33
- 资源: 5321
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- json的合法基色来自红包东i请各位
- 项目采用YOLO V4算法模型进行目标检测,使用Deep SORT目标跟踪算法 .zip
- 针对实时视频流和静态图像实现的对象检测和跟踪算法 .zip
- 部署 yolox 算法使用 deepstream.zip
- 基于webmagic、springboot和mybatis的MagicToe Java爬虫设计源码
- 通过实时流协议 (RTSP) 使用 Yolo、OpenCV 和 Python 进行深度学习的对象检测.zip
- 基于Python和HTML的tb商品列表查询分析设计源码
- 基于国民技术RT-THREAD的MULTInstrument多功能电子测量仪器设计源码
- 基于Java技术的网络报修平台后端设计源码
- 基于Python的美食杰中华菜系数据挖掘与分析设计源码